England Women’s Team Beat Pakistan by 8 Wickets in Sydney

During the ICC Women’s Cricket World Cup on Thursday 12th  March 2009, England and Pakistan played at North Sydney Oval Sydney Australian. The Match was starts at 10.00am. Pakistan Women won the toss and elected to bat first.  The Consul General of Pakistan Mr. Azam Mohammed, Consul Syed Khalid Mahmood, Manager Pakistan International Airlines Australia Mr. Nadeem Jaffar,  Chief Executive Officer Citilink Finance Mr. Muhammad Asif, President Pakistan Association of Australia Mr. Ejaz Khan  and a large crowd of Pakistani cricket fans supported the Pakistan Women's Team at North Oval in Sydney.   Fox Sports televised Women's World Cup Match of England and Pakistan, As a result England won the match.
